Henry Botkin (1896-1983) was an American abstract, modern and expressionist painter and illustrator; he was known for his figure-views, still lifes, and non-objective paintings. He was active in artistic circles, served as president of four major art organizations (Artists Equity Association, American Abstract Artists, Group 256 Provincetown, and Federation of Modern Painters and Sculptors), and in 1955 organized the first exhibition of American abstract art at the Museum of Modern Art in Tokyo,...
